Trip Overview

The average bus between Milan and Quarante takes 20h 50m and the fastest bus takes 17h 7m. There is at least one bus per day from Milan to Quarante.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.

Milan to Quarante bus times

Buses run once daily between Milan and Quarante. The earliest departure is at 6:50 PM in the evening, and the last departure from Milan is at 10:00 PM which arrives into Quarante at 6:10 PM. All services require a transfer at Montpellier - Sabines Bus Station and take an average of 20h 50m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.
